Hostwinds 教程

寻找结果为:


目录


步骤1:安装IIS和FTP服务
什么是II?
1。打开服务器管理器
2。启动"添加角色和功能"向导
3。选择安装类型
4。选择服务器
5。安装Web服务器(IIS)
6。添加FTP服务器角色
7.完成安装
步骤2:创建和配置FTP网站
1。打开IIS经理
2。添加一个新的FTP网站
3。配置FTP网站基础知识
4。配置绑定和SSL
5。设置身份验证和授权
6。完成向导
7。重新启动服务器(可选但建议)
步骤3:与您的FTP客户端联系
连接信息:
快速提示

在Windows Server中安装FTP

标签: Windows,  FTP 

步骤1:安装IIS和FTP服务
什么是II?
1。打开服务器管理器
2。启动"添加角色和功能"向导
3。选择安装类型
4。选择服务器
5。安装Web服务器(IIS)
6。添加FTP服务器角色
7.完成安装
步骤2:创建和配置FTP网站
1。打开IIS经理
2。添加一个新的FTP网站
3。配置FTP网站基础知识
4。配置绑定和SSL
5。设置身份验证和授权
6。完成向导
7。重新启动服务器(可选但建议)
步骤3:与您的FTP客户端联系
连接信息:
快速提示

如果您需要在本地网络和Windows Server之间移动文件,则FTP(文件传输协议)是最有效,最广泛支持的方法之一。正确设置它可以帮助您更轻松地管理上传,备份,网站文件和软件更新。

在本指南中,我们将浏览如何使用 IIS(互联网信息服务),它内置在Windows Server中。您还将了解为什么每个步骤都很重要,因此您不仅遵循说明,还可以建立真正的理解。

步骤1:安装IIS和FTP服务

在设置FTP之前,您需要一项服务来管理它。在Windows Server上,该服务是 II。FTP作为IIS的一部分运行,该IIS通常用于托管网站,但还包括处理文件传输的能力。

什么是II?

互联网信息服务(IIS) 是微软的Web服务器软件。虽然通常用于托管网站,但它还包括可选功能,例如FTP服务。通过安装IIS,您可以添加Windows Server所需的工具来管理和配置FTP访问。

1。打开服务器管理器

服务器管理器是用于向Windows Server添加功能或角色的主要控制面板。您可以通过服务器管理器安装大多数Windows Server功能,包括IIS和FTP。它集中了配置,因此您无需手动或通过命令行安装内容。

这是您的工作方式:

  • 点击 Windows/Start按钮
  • 搜索 服务器管理器
  • 从结果中打开它

2。启动"添加角色和功能"向导

一旦您进入服务器管理器:

  • 请点击 管理 在右上角
  • 选择 添加角色和功能

为什么这很重要: 角色是主要服务器功能(例如Web服务器或DNS)。功能是支持工具(例如.NET或IIS管理)。这个向导可以逐步安装所需的内容。

3。选择安装类型

在安装类型屏幕上,选择:

  • 基于角色或基于功能的安装
  • 请点击 下一个

此选项使您可以在当前服务器上安装角色和功能。另一个选项是用于远程设置或虚拟环境。

4。选择服务器

  • 从列表中选择您的服务器(通常会预选)
  • 请点击 下一个

为什么这很重要: 在具有多个服务器的环境中,此步骤确保您将角色添加到正确的角色。

5。安装Web服务器(IIS)

服务器角色 屏幕:

  • 查找并检查 Web服务器(IIS)
  • 弹出窗口可能会要求您安装所需的功能。点击 添加功能

如果已经检查了Web服务器(IIS),则表示已安装IIS。您可以在稍后跳到FTP配置部分。

这是允许您配置和托管FTP网站的核心服务。

6。添加FTP服务器角色

继续进行 角色服务 屏幕(在Web服务器角色下):

  • 寻找 FTP服务器
  • 两者都检查:
    • FTP服务
    • FTP的可扩展性 (可选,但对扩展配置有用)

另外,请确保在管理工具下检查IIS管理控制台(这提供了您稍后使用的接口)。

没有FTP角色,您将没有通过IIS配置或运行FTP网站所需的工具。

7.完成安装

  • 请点击 安装
  • 等待进度栏完成
  • 完成后,您可能需要重新启动服务器

安装角色可能需要几分钟。重新启动有助于最终完成对系统服务的任何更改。

步骤2:创建和配置FTP网站

现在安装了IIS和FTP,是时候实际创建FTP网站了。这就是允许远程用户(像您一样,从本地计算机)上传,下载或管理服务器上的文件的原因。

1。打开IIS经理

IIS Manager是您在IIS下配置所有服务的地方,包括网站,绑定和FTP。

  • 转到: 控制面板>系统和安全>管理工具
  • 打开 互联网信息服务(IIS)经理

或者,按 Windows + R> 类型 'inetmgr',然后按 输入.

IIS Manager为您提供了一个视觉接口来管理服务器设置,使设置和故障排除更加容易。

2。添加一个新的FTP网站

在左侧面板中(称为 连接数 窗格):

  • 单击箭头以展开服务器的节点
  • 右键点击 网站
  • 选择 添加FTP网站

这将打开一个向导,以帮助您配置FTP服务器。

3。配置FTP网站基础知识

站点名称:

  • 您可以使用任何名称。这只是IIS管理器内部使用的标签(例如,我的FTP网站)。

物理路径:

  • 选择要FTP服务器指向的文件夹。
    • 示例:C:\将允许FTP访问整个驱动器
    • 您还可以指定一个更有限的文件夹,例如C:\ ftpfiles \

这是将文件上传到或从中下载的地方。如果您只希望用户访问某个目录,请不要选择根驱动器。

4。配置绑定和SSL

IP地址和端口:

  • 将其作为默认值(FTP的端口21)
  • 如果您的服务器有多个,请选择正确的IP地址

SSL设置:

  • 选择 没有SSL 现在除非安装了SSL证书
    • (您可以稍后使用FTP添加安全的FTP)

默认情况下,FTP未加密。FTPS使用SSL添加安全性,但需要证书。对于基本设置,没有SSL是可以接受的,但不适合公众使用。

5。设置身份验证和授权

验证方式:

  • 选择 基本 (要求用户登录)
  • 查看 匿名

授权:

  • 选择 指定的用户
  • 输入管理员(或您已经创建的其他Windows用户)
  • 设置权限级别:
    • 读: 仅供下载
    • 读写: 上传和下载

这可以控制谁可以访问您的FTP网站以及他们可以做什么。出于安全原因,避免使用匿名访问。

6。完成向导

  • 查看您的设置
  • 请点击

您现在创建了FTP网站!

7。重新启动服务器(可选但建议)

重新启动您的服务器以确保正确加载所有服务。

步骤3:与您的FTP客户端联系

设置完成后,您可以使用FTP客户端从计算机连接到FTP服务器。

  • FileZilla
  • WinSCP
  • 数码鸭

连接信息:

  • 主持人: 服务器的IP地址
  • 用户名: 管理员(或您授权的帐户)
  • 密码: 该用户的Windows密码
  • 港口: 21

快速提示

  • 确保 端口21 在您的防火墙上开放
  • 确认 FTP服务正在运行 在IIS经理中
  • 检查 用户帐户 有权访问文件夹
  • 尝试从另一台计算机连接以排除客户端问题

与往常一样,如果您在完成此操作时遇到任何问题或需要进一步的帮助,请联系我们的24/7在线聊天以寻求帮助。

撰写者 Hostwinds Team  /  四月 19, 2018